Internet Speed Drop Inside: If you live in most parts of Bangladesh (especially Dhaka) and step outside, you’ll notice that your internet connection is much faster than inside. You may also pay for a high-speed broadband internet connection, but find that it is still not fast enough at home. The problematic factor isn’t necessarily with your internet service provider; rather, it’s typically related to the environment.

Reasons Why Your Internet Doesn’t Work Well Indoors

Thick Walls

In Bangladesh, most homes use brick and concrete for their construction — great for durability but not so great for transmitting WiFi signals. These types of materials block and absorb signals and are especially problematic when the wireless router is in a different room.

Too Many Networks

It is common to find many different WiFi networks running at the same time on many apartment building floors, and most of these networks share the same 2.4 GHz frequency (i.e., frequency interferes with one another), making it very difficult to retrieve a good signal from your network.

Old Routers

Many homes in Bangladesh are using low-cost wireless routers that cannot handle higher-speed internet connections. Therefore, if you subscribe to an internet service that has speeds of 50 —100 Mbps, that plan is limited by the ability of your wireless router, so you only receive about 20 —30 Mbps.

Distance

As you get farther away from the wireless router, the WiFi signal gets weaker. With the addition of walls and pieces of furniture placed around your living space, the signal gets weaker and therefore slower.

Top 3 Hacks to Boost Your WiFi Signal

1. Position Your Router Appropriately

  • This is an easy solution to an otherwise common problem.
  • Locate your router in a central area (if possible).
  • Place it on a shelf or high spot so that the signal can travel freely.

Avoid having walls or other materials (e.g. metallic items, microwaves, etc) between the router and any intended use of the device.

This means you also don’t want to place it in a corner or inside a closed cabinet. A small change to the router’s location could produce a large increase in performance.

2. Change from 2.4 GHz to 5 GHz Band and Use More Optimal Channels

If your router is dual-band, it should allow you to use the 5GHz frequency because it has less congestion than the 2.4GHz frequency and is faster than using the 2.4GHz frequency, plus it is a better option for video streaming and gaming.

You can also monitor the level of congestion on each band and each channel by using the WiFi Analyser app. If you find that the 2.4GHz channels are congested, you can try using channels 1, 6, or 11 to see if the performance improves, as these channels are considered optimal for 2.4GHz.

3. Place a WiFi Extender from Device to Endless Coverage

With there being so many rooms in a house, it’s possible that only using a single router may not be enough.

If your home can benefit from multiple routers, using devices such as the TP-Link RE200 or Cudy RE300 has been shown to help provide WiFi coverage throughout the home by transmitting the signal through walls and effectively enhancing it in the areas with the weakest coverage.
